Burgeoning Generative AI Propels Global Economy Forward

Explosive growth in generative artificial intelligence (AI) technology is rapidly advancing, as indicated by a report from renowned management consulting firm McKinsey & Company. The emergence and widespread adoption of generative AI tools are expected to contribute a staggering $2.6 to $4.4 trillion annually to the global economy, which is on par with the combined productivity scale of Taiwan over the past four years. These numbers not only demonstrate the soaring acceptance of generative AI globally but also its exponential growth in innovative services. One prominent initiative in the field is the “Generative AI Startup Challenge,” set for May, which is crafted collaboratively by Taiwania Capital and AWS, with support from NVIDIA. This platform aims to unveil creative and potential-filled new startup teams in Taiwan.

The winning teams of this challenge are to gain access to a wealth of resources including AWS’s extensive knowledge in AI/ML, specialized generative AI development platforms, and a vast startup ecosystem. With comprehensive support encompassing professional tech, cloud resources, and venture capital matchmaking, budding generative AI ideas are anticipated to attain perfection and commercial fruition.

The intensive two-month program involves mentoring, one-on-one technical consultations with AWS professionals, deep-dive generative AI tech workshops co-hosted by AWS and NVIDIA, and hands-on proposal rehearsal for venture capitalists, with product optimization feedback.

Additionally, on the finale day, each selected startup team will have 10 minutes to pitch directly to Taiwania Capital, AWS, and NVIDIA, showcasing their innovative product concepts. The top three teams will have the opportunity to win up to $25,000 in AWS credits and entry into NVIDIA’s INCEPTION PROGRAM, along with a chance to receive a mystery prize from NVIDIA.

The Role of Generative AI in Transforming the Economy

Generative AI refers to the subset of artificial intelligence technologies that can generate new content, ranging from text and images to code and beyond. The impact of generative AI on the global economy is substantial; it’s believed to streamline operations across various industries, thus potentially boosting productivity and innovation.

Key Questions and Answers:

Q1: What industries could benefit most from generative AI?
A1: Industries such as marketing, entertainment, pharmaceuticals, automotive, and technology stand to gain significantly from the efficiency and creativity enhancements that generative AI promises.

Q2: What are the challenges and controversies associated with generative AI?
A2: Some key challenges include ensuring data privacy, managing AI-generated misinformation or deepfakes, addressing the threats to traditional jobs, and establishing ethical frameworks for AI use.

Advantages:
Innovation Acceleration: Generative AI can lead to the development of new products and services by enabling rapid prototyping and creative design processes.
Efficiency Improvement: Automating routine tasks and content generation can save time and resources, freeing up human capital for more complex tasks.
Data Analysis: AI can analyze large datasets more quickly and accurately than humans, leading to more informed decision-making.

Disadvantages:
Unemployment Risks: Generative AI can replace certain jobs, particularly those involving routine or repetitive tasks.
Quality Concerns: AI-generated content may not always meet the standards set by human-generated content, leading to potential quality control issues.
Behavioral Exploitation: Ethical concerns arise when AI is used to manipulate consumer behavior or generate deepfakes.
